Description
A bittersweet comedy that follows the relationship that develops between nursing home residents Fonsia Dorsey and Weller Martin during a series of gin games. As the games progress, their ailments, misfortunes, and losses are exposed in funny, honest, and increasingly heated moments, and what begins as a tentative friendship quickly turns into a battle of wills.
